Global Market Overview & Dynamics of HVAC Systems Used AC Drives Market Analysis

The global HVAC systems used AC drives market is experiencing a steady and positive growth trajectory, fundamentally driven by the global imperative for energy conservation. AC drives, particularly Variable Frequency Drives (VFDs), have become integral components for modulating motor speeds in fans, pumps, and compressors, thereby significantly reducing energy consumption compared to traditional fixed-speed systems. This transition is supported by increasing environmental awareness, stringent governmental policies, and the continuous growth in construction activities worldwide. The market's dynamics are shaped by a balance of technological innovation, economic factors, and regional construction trends.

Global HVAC Systems Used AC Drives Market Drivers

  • Stringent Energy Efficiency Regulations: Governments and international bodies are implementing strict regulations and standards to reduce the carbon footprint of buildings. AC drives help meet these targets by drastically cutting the energy consumption of HVAC systems, which are among the largest power consumers in commercial buildings.

  • Rising Urbanization and Construction Activity: The global surge in the construction of smart, green buildings, especially in emerging economies, is a major driver. New commercial, residential, and industrial constructions are increasingly incorporating energy-efficient HVAC solutions from the outset to ensure long-term operational viability and compliance.

  • Focus on Reducing Operational Costs: With energy prices on the rise, building owners and facility managers are increasingly focused on minimizing operational expenditures. The significant energy savings offered by AC drives provide a compelling return on investment, driving their adoption in both new installations and retrofitting projects.

Global HVAC Systems Used AC Drives Market Trends

  • Integration with IoT and Building Automation Systems (BAS): The trend towards smart buildings is fueling the demand for AC drives that can be seamlessly integrated with IoT platforms and BAS. This allows for real-time monitoring, remote control, data analytics, and predictive maintenance, leading to optimized system performance.

  • Development of Compact and User-Friendly Drives: Manufacturers are focusing on developing more compact, cost-effective, and easier-to-install AC drives. This trend is helping to lower the barriers to adoption, particularly for smaller commercial applications and retrofitting projects where space and technical expertise may be limited.

  • Growing Demand for Decentralized HVAC Systems: The shift towards decentralized systems, such as Variable Refrigerant Flow (VRF) and dedicated outdoor air systems, often incorporates multiple smaller motors. This creates a broader application base for low-power AC drives, expanding the market beyond traditional large, centralized systems.

Global HVAC Systems Used AC Drives Market Restraints

  • High Initial Investment Cost: The upfront cost of purchasing and installing AC drives can be significantly higher than traditional motor control systems. This can be a major deterrent for small to medium-sized enterprises or for projects with tight budgets, despite the long-term savings.

  • Lack of Technical Expertise: The proper installation, commissioning, and maintenance of AC drives require specialized technical skills. A shortage of qualified technicians in certain regions can hinder market growth and lead to improper installations that fail to deliver expected energy savings.

  • Potential for Power Quality Issues: If not properly installed with appropriate filters, AC drives can introduce harmonic distortions into the electrical grid. This can negatively affect other sensitive electronic equipment and may require additional investment in mitigation measures, adding to the overall system complexity and cost.

Regional Dynamics:

Drivers

  • Stringent building codes and energy efficiency standards (e.g., ASHRAE 90.1).

  • Government incentives and rebates for retrofitting old buildings with energy-efficient technologies.

  • High adoption rate of smart building technologies and building automation systems.

Trends

  • Focus on retrofitting existing commercial and public buildings to reduce energy consumption.

  • Increasing integration of AC drives with cloud-based analytics for performance optimization.

  • Growing demand for drives with low harmonic distortion to comply with power quality standards like IEEE 519.

Restraints

  • Market maturity in certain segments, leading to slower growth compared to developing regions.

  • Complexity and cost associated with integrating new drives into legacy HVAC systems.

  • Competition from other energy-saving measures and technologies.

Technology Focus

The region shows a strong preference for advanced AC drives with integrated network communication protocols (like BACnet and Modbus) for seamless connection to Building Management Systems (BMS). There is also a significant focus on drives with active front-end technology to mitigate harmonics and improve power quality, especially in sensitive environments like data centers and hospitals.

Technology Focus

Europe is a leader in adopting AC drives that comply with the highest ecodesign regulations (e.g., EN 50598-2) for energy efficiency. The focus is on system-level efficiency (motor + drive). There is a growing trend towards integrated "drive-on-motor" solutions, which reduce cabinet size and simplify installation, particularly in OEM applications.

Technology Focus

The market demands high-performance, robust AC drives capable of operating reliably in high ambient temperatures and dusty conditions. There is a strong focus on high-power drives for large centrifugal chillers and pumps used in district cooling. Integration with sophisticated building management systems is standard for major projects in the region.
